The birth of an idea

The idea for Kindred was born out of personal experiences. In early 2017, our daughter was born while we were living in a flat in Notting Hill, West London.

As first-time parents, Adam and I found ourselves overwhelmed, not just by the demands of parenting, but also by the challenge of finding family-friendly places that accommodated our needs.

It often felt like an endless trial-and-error process to discover the cafés with space for a pushchair, the restaurants with changing tables, the location for baby music classes, or basically anywhere that catered to parents with babies.

Need for a better way

We’d spend hours searching Google, TripAdvisor, and Facebook groups, only to get the best recommendations through word of mouth from other moms or by scouting locations where we could see pushchairs.

Eventually, we found our favorite go-to spots. But many days, it was easier to stay at home than face the stress of trying to find a new place that worked for us.

It was in these moments of frustration that the seed idea for Kindred was planted — we knew there had to be a better way for parents to navigate this.

New city, new challenges

Later in 2017, we moved to Edinburgh, Scotland, with our 7-month-old daughter, only to start the process all over again. In a new city, with its infamous wind and rain, the search for family-friendly indoor spots became an important aspect.

And by late 2018, we had welcomed our son, and the search expanded. Which museums were free and had play areas? Are there microwaves to reheat homemade toddler meals? Which cafés had high chairs, pushchair access, and kid meals? Which playground was fenced so our toddler could run around safely while I breastfed our baby?

It became clear that parents needed a one-stop solution, and the idea for Kindred continued to grow.

Taking root in Sweden

In 2019, our family relocated again — this time to Gothenburg, Sweden. With three countries now under our belt, the challenge of finding family-friendly places in yet another new city was daunting.

Thankfully, I found active Facebook groups where local parents shared valuable tips, and that’s when I realized the power of collective parent knowledge.

I began pitching the idea of Kindred to friends and family, and the response was overwhelming: “Is it available in my area?” and "When can I download the app?" It was then that Adam and I decided to start working on Kindred in earnest and let the idea of Kindred take root and grow.

Resilience through the pandemic

Then, 2020 hit. Like many families, we faced the challenges of the pandemic, but we also welcomed our third child, born in early 2021.

Despite the chaos, the dream of Kindred remained strong.

In fact, the need to support parents became even more urgent as lockdowns and isolation made parenting even more stressful and family outings and community connections harder than ever.

Creation of Synova Technology

By early 2022, we had built many of the first Figma prototypes and started conducting early user interviews. Yes, progress was slow—balancing life as parents of three kids in a country where we were still learning the language was overwhelming—but our commitment to Kindred and seeing it flourish never wavered.

In October 2022, Adam and I officially founded Synova Technology, the company behind Kindred. As bootstrappers funding our dream, Adam balances his work as a CTO coach and Fractional CTO for startups, while also serving as Kindred’s co-founder and CTO.

My background in product development and commercialization complements his expertise, creating a strong partnership as we build Kindred from the ground up.
